HP extends LaserJet range

Jul 9, 2018 | 0 comments

The OEM has announced the expansion of its LaserJet line of printers in the CEMA region (Central Europe, Middle East and Africa) with the MFP M436 series.

The series is specifically designed for SMBs, and is “designed to be affordable and reliable”, according to itp.net.

The machines offer automatic two-sided printing, copying, and scanning, with speeds of up to 23 ppm, meaning “no-one will be waiting for printing for long.” They also include four pre-programmed quick-launch buttons, scan to PC functionality, and built-in Ethernet networking and remote monitoring.

“Small and medium sized businesses must invest wisely in technology that adds value, boosts efficiency, guarantees quality and facilitates streamlined operations, all whilst keeping a close eye on budgets,” explained Stephane Rogier, head of HP Inc.’s Print Business Unit. “The new LaserJet MFP M436 series printer provides high-quality, reliable printing for thousands of pages. Plus, with the thoughtful design and pre-programmed quick-launch capabilities, the modern office should not be without one.”
